What to do in Vernon, Texas, United States of America

Located in the northern region of Texas, Vernon is a small city that is known for its rich culture, history, and picturesque natural landscapes. From historic landmarks to outdoor recreational activities, there are plenty of top tourist attractions that make Vernon a must-visit destination for tourists planning their trip to Texas.

Here are some of the top tourist attractions in Vernon, Texas.

1. Red River Valley Museum

The Red River Valley Museum is a popular attraction in Vernon for those who want to learn more about the history and culture of the North Texas region. The museum has a wide range of exhibits, including a collection of pioneer and Native American artifacts, antique firearms, and vintage farm equipment. It also features displays that show the early days of cattle ranching and oil drilling in the region.

2. Copper Breaks State Park

The Copper Breaks State Park is a stunning natural attraction in Vernon that offers an array of outdoor activities for visitors to enjoy. The park is renowned for its breathtaking views of the rugged canyons and rugged rock formations. Visitors can explore the trails, relax at the fishing pond, watch wildlife, or stargaze at the park's Dark Sky area.

3. Wilbarger County Courthouse

As one of the most iconic landmarks in Vernon, the Wilbarger County Courthouse is a must-visit for those who want to learn more about the city's history and architecture. Built in 1928, the building's Spanish Colonial Revival style design makes it a standout landmark in the city.

4. Doan's Crossing

Doan's Crossing is an iconic historical landmark located near Vernon that holds deep roots in Texas history. This site is where the famous chase of Quanah Parker, the Comanche chief happened in 1874. You can explore the plaques and markers which has details of the battle and the famous escapades of the Quanah Parker.

5. Kiowa Casino and Hotel

For those looking for some entertainment, the Kiowa Casino and Hotel is a popular attraction in Vernon. It features numerous slot machines, table games, and live entertainment on weekends. The resort also has a hotel where tourists can stay and enjoy the amenities and services provided by hotel.

6. Lake Kemp

Lake Kemp is a great spot for outdoor enthusiasts, whether it be fishing, boating or just soaking up in the sun. It is one of the largest lakes in the region with many small beaches surrounding the area, and you can even do a little bit of bird watching.
